class Database {
constructor(worker) {
if (Database.instance) {
return Database.instance
}
this.query = {
table: null,
conditions: [],
};
this.worker = worker;
Database.instance = this;
}
static async initialize() {
if (Database.instance) {
return Database.instance
}
let sqworker = new Worker(new URL("./sqlite-worker.js", import.meta.url), { type: "module" });
Database.instance = new Database(sqworker);
await Database.instance.sendToWorker(['initialize', { name: 'dobby.sqlite', debug: true }]);
return Database.instance;
}
async sendToWorker(message) {
return new Promise((resolve, reject) => {
const onError = (error) => {
this.worker.removeEventListener('error', onError);
reject(error);
};
this.worker.addEventListener('error', onError);
this.worker.postMessage(message);
this.worker.addEventListener('message', (event) => {
if (event.data[0] === 'response') {
this.worker.removeEventListener('error', onError);
resolve(event.data[1]);
}
});
});
}
async execute(sql) {
return await this.sendToWorker(['execute', { sql }]);
}
from(tableName) {
this.query.conditions = [];
this.query.table = tableName;
return this;
}
where(column, operator, value) {
if (typeof column === 'function') {
// Subquery
const subquery = new Database(this.worker);
column(subquery);
const subquerySQL = subquery.buildQuery();
this.query.conditions.push(`(${subquerySQL})`);
} else {
this.query.conditions.push({ column, operator, value });
}
return this;
}
orWhere(column, operator, value) {
if (this.query.conditions.length === 0) {
throw new Error("No previous 'where' condition to combine with 'orWhere'.");
}
this.query.conditions.push('OR');
this.query.conditions.push({ column, operator, value });
return this;
}
where(column, operator, value) {
this.query.conditions.push({ column, operator, value });
return this;
}
groupBy(column) {
this.query.groupBy = column;
return this;
}
having(column, operator, value) {
this.query.having = { column, operator, value };
return this;
}
async get() {
const sql = this.buildQuery();
console.log(sql);
return await this.execute(sql);
}
async find(id) {
if (!this.query.table) {
throw new Error("Table name not specified. Call 'from' method first.");
}
this.query.conditions = [{ column: 'id', operator: '=', value: id }];
const sql = this.buildQuery();
const result = await this.execute(sql);
return { result: result.success, data: result.data[0] };
}
to(tableName) {
this.query.table = tableName;
return this;
}
// New method to create a new record
async create(data) {
console.log(data);
if (!this.query.table) {
throw new Error("Table name not specified. Call 'to' method first.");
}
const columns = Object.keys(data);
const values = Object.values(data);
const columnString = columns.join(', ');
const valuePlaceholders = columns.map(() => '?').join(', ');
const sql = `INSERT INTO ${this.query.table} (${columnString}) VALUES (${valuePlaceholders}) returning *`;
const result = await this.execute({ sql, params: values });
return { result: result.success, data: result.data[0] };
}
// New method to update an existing record by ID
async update(id, data) {
if (!this.query.table) {
throw new Error("Table name not specified. Call 'to' method first.");
}
const columns = Object.keys(data);
const values = Object.values(data);
const updates = columns.map((column) => `${column} = ?`).join(', ');
const sql = `UPDATE ${this.query.table} SET ${updates} WHERE id = ? returning *`;
const result = await this.execute({ sql, params: [...values, id] });
return { result: result.success, data: result.data[0] };
}
// New method to delete a record by ID
async delete(id) {
if (!this.query.table) {
throw new Error("Table name not specified. Call 'to' method first.");
}
const sql = `DELETE FROM ${this.query.table} WHERE id = ?`;
const result = await this.execute({ sql, params: [id] });
return { result: result.success, data: result.data[0] };
}
buildQuery() {
let sql = `SELECT * FROM ${this.query.table}`;
if (this.query.conditions.length > 0) {
sql += ' WHERE ';
for (const condition of this.query.conditions) {
sql += `${condition.column} ${condition.operator} '${condition.value}' AND `;
}
// Remove the trailing ' AND '
sql = sql.slice(0, -5);
}
return sql;
}
toQuery() {
const sql = this.buildQuery();
const bindings = this.query.conditions
.filter((condition) => typeof condition !== 'string')
.map((condition) => condition.value);
const queryWithValues = sql.replace(/\?/g, (match) => {
const value = bindings.shift();
if (typeof value === 'string') {
return `'${value}'`;
}
return value;
});
return queryWithValues;
}
async paginate(perPage, page = 1) {
if (!this.query.table) {
throw new Error("Table name not specified. Call 'from' method first.");
}
if (!perPage || isNaN(perPage) || perPage <= 0) {
throw new Error("Invalid 'perPage' value.");
}
if (!page || isNaN(page) || page <= 0) {
throw new Error("Invalid 'page' value.");
}
const offset = (page - 1) * perPage;
const sql = this.buildQuery() + ` LIMIT ${perPage} OFFSET ${offset}`;
const result = await this.execute(sql);
return {
current_page: page,
per_page: perPage,
total: result.data?.length || 0,
data: result.data,
};
}
// added here so that we don't need to install more dependencies?
generateUUID = () => {
let
d = new Date().getTime(),
d2 = ((typeof performance !== 'undefined') && performance.now && (performance.now() * 1000)) || 0;
return 'xxxxxxxx-xxxx-4xxx-yxxx-xxxxxxxxxxxx'.replace(/[xy]/g, c => {
let r = Math.random() * 16;
if (d > 0) {
r = (d + r) % 16 | 0;
d = Math.floor(d / 16);
} else {
r = (d2 + r) % 16 | 0;
d2 = Math.floor(d2 / 16);
}
return (c == 'x' ? r : (r & 0x7 | 0x8)).toString(16);
});
};
}
